Preguntas frecuentes sobre Kenwood

¿Cuál es el precio y la disponibilidad actual de los apartamentos en alquiler en el área de Kenwood en Chicago, IL?

A día de hoy, 22 de Agosto, 2026, hay 272 apartamentos disponibles en Kenwood con precios desde $980 hasta $4,600 y un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,371.

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Kenwood?

Actualmente hay 191 Apartamentos Estudios en Kenwood con alquileres que van desde $980 hasta $2,010, con un precio medio de $1,396.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Kenwood?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Kenwood varian entre $1,230 y $2,635 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,932

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Kenwood?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Kenwood van desde $1,555 hasta $4,025.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,510

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Kenwood?

En estos momentos hay 38 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Kenwood en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,782 y $4,600 - con una media de $3,477 para el lugar.
